What is the minimum number of nodes required in a cluster for enabling Erasure Coding?
Suggested Answer: C Vote an answer
The correct answer isC. 4
Erasure Coding (EC-X)in Nutanix is a data efficiency feature that replaces multiple replicas with parity data to reduce storage overhead while still protecting against failures. Theminimum node requirementfor enabling Erasure Coding is4 nodes, due to the need to distribute data and parity across multiple failure domains.
Details:
* RF2 with EC-Xrequires at least4 nodes.
* RF3 with EC-Xrequiresat least 6 or 8 nodes, depending on configuration.
Prism UI Navigation Path:
Storage > Storage Containers > Enable EC-X
